More about the book
Set in a post-Soviet landscape, the narrative explores a world where vampires have expanded their reign beyond Eastern Europe, transforming entire populations into vampires or subjugating them as livestock. As they overrun regions like India, the Far East, and major cities in the Americas, the forces of Night are now encroaching upon rural areas to solidify their dominance, creating a chilling atmosphere of fear and survival amidst a global vampire epidemic.
